Question
I am wondering. I bought a Weywood Wakefield Baby Buggy at an antique show. The wicker is in very good condition. The material is dirty stained but all there with minimal damage if any. One of the rubber wheels is missing about an inch and the rest of the wheel rubber is all there but a little warped. There is a reference plate on the inside bottom and the original paper "Do Not Remove This Tag" attached to the outside with original wire. Can you give me any ballpark at to what something like that is worth. Thanks Tuesday Chesser
I am not a collector of this sort of item but I have a granddaughter that I think would like to push it around the house. Do you know where i might get some lining for it. Don't really have the extra time to make it.

Answer
The lining for this would have to be made.Many of the buggies used corduroy as the material. The rubber for the tires is not available anywhere to my knowledge. You would probably need to find a subtile replacement and glue it in place.
 I see these carriages from $50. up to $100. ,it just depends on the year of manufacturing and design.
